Output 5040742568d53e56eb3791acbdc34adcc985c18a202c80a25f06bfeb5d1da977:1

value
73028288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d5cdbd449b2f6480956088a90976e6ed06c189 OP_EQUAL
address
MFzspegzZMjnM4zKUmUrxRVqbCuomzFAJF
transaction
5040742568d53e56eb3791acbdc34adcc985c18a202c80a25f06bfeb5d1da977
spent
true